Question

What do you understand by the term valency?


Open in App
Solution

Valency

  • The number of electrons gained/losed or shared by an atom to take part in a bond formation is called valency.
  • When an atom loses electrons, the number of protons become more than the number of electrons and a positive ion will form, that is called a positive valency.
  • When an atom attain stability by gaining electrons, the number of electrons become more than the number of protons and a negative ion will form, that is called a negative valency.
  • Ceratin elements can share electrons to get a stable electronic configuration like carbon.The electron shared in those cases is the valency of that particular element.
  • Taking an example oxygen having electronic configuration 2,6.
  • It accept two electron to attain octect configuration.
  • Thus the valency is 2 which is negative due to gaining of electron.
